Summary | 0000891: Adding the possibility to rename/delete mixer group | ||||
Description | It would be nice to be able to rename, or delete a previously created mixer group, as sometimes it's common to create a group to link some tracks that are afterwards eliminated, and the group name created for them has no sense/utility... So they would acumulate to an "infinite" names group list... It would be most intuitive (perhaps) to be done as follows: right mouse button click over the mixer group ---> rename ; delete ; (un)link gain; etc... Or perhaps just within the menu that appears when left clicking the "mixer groups"... etc. | ||||
